Royal Family News: Prince Harry And Meghan Show Off Their Superiority And Get It All Wrong
British royal family news shows that Prince Harry and Meghan Markle are getting flak for their latest unsolicited lecture to the masses. Why did they totally snub UK mental health organizations when they tried to assert themselves into a…